Abstract
The article considers the process of internationalization of Higher education as a factor of improving the quality of education. The main trends of modern higher education are defined. To ensure a competitive position in the global education market, the countries have United in a single system of education – the Bologna process. The Bologna process contributed to the process of internationalization of Higher education institutions in the RF. The internationalization of Russia's human capital will increase the competitiveness of universities and will allow integration into the world system of higher education. Many Russian universities successfully participate in the process of internationalization to improve the quality indicators. The system of internationalization of the University includes the processes of interaction between the University and partner Universities (participants of the Bologna process abroad), through negotiations, joint projects, programs "DOUBLE DIPLOMA", conferences, cooperation agreements, memorandums of understanding, etc. The student - the bearer of human and intellectual capital, participates in the processes of internationalization by self-selection, realization of their needs for obtaining new knowledge, skills and skills at the international level.
